Gateways by Trauma
[nfo]
screenshot added by shadez on 2003-02-23 16:34:09
platform :
type :
release date : august 1998
release party : Assembly 1998
compo : pc demo
ranked : 1st

Hey,. I didn't remember knewing about the Win32 port! And I found accidentally this demo. Btw,. this demo isn't very popular,. haven't heard anything about that..

It starts very cool (With the particle explotion writting the logo, but it really spoils in some parts (While some other parts could make a very cool demo!))
It is sad because some parts & fx are very good, but some other really ugly 3d (the trees, the waterfall, the spaceships with lame 3d gfx..) spoils the thign..

I liked also very much the 3d random walker thing!!! Ohh,. and the trance music of course!

It could be a great demo without some ugly looking parts and details. Some fx ruled!
